My train journey from Banglore to Chennai was too nostalgic. The few trips that I had travelled from Banglore with my kids,alone,was a nightmare.Rolling on the floor, jumping from upper to the lower berth, crying, asking for everything that was sold,not eating, vomiting,pouring the water, dancing all the steps that were taught, opening the eyes of the passengers who were fast asleep in the A.C coach,pulling the blankets of the old passengers, wanting to go out of the compartment and hitting the passengers sitting near the door............ omg............ (andJi thought that my brother's words were true.They were so hyper because I had prayed to Lord Hanuman during my pregnancyJ) And me avoiding the irritated, angry, sympathetic, annoying looks of the co passengers. I could read their mind,”Who asked her to travel with these kinds of kids?" I was unable to handle them............and thought that i will never recommend two kids to anybody. I hoped for the day to travel alone, to read a book , enjoy music, sleep, and calmly enjoy the nature passing by.

Alas!!! The day came with my little Varsh all grown up, bidding good bye , assuring me with full confidence that she will take care of herself.I boarded the brightly painted double decker train with a book in my hand. Wow!  I got a separate window seat.It was very narrow, reminding me that I should go on GM diet next time;)

But as the train started moving, I was not able to read a single line from the book or close my eyes for a minute, enjoy the drizzle or the nature passing by. There was nobody to pull my duppatta, my hair, my glasses.All along I was only thinking of my little ones...............
